Associate Director /Director Credit Risk Management
Work Location : Singapore
Work Mode: Hybrid


Summary
The client provides financial expertise and industry knowledge to support its customers and markets. As part of a strong and established team of project and structured finance risk managers you will support the Banks continued growth with a focus on Corporate Lending and Leveraged Buyout transactions.

Youll make a difference in:
  • Risk Analysis: Conduct thorough risk analysis for corporate and leveraged loans in the Asia Australia region.
  • Underwriting Management: Manage underwriting processes emphasizing risk assessment analysing historical performance security and legal structure.
  • Team Coordination: Coordinate workstreams across teams (Rating Legal Tax Compliance Operations) during underwriting and portfolio monitoring.
  • Risk/Return Evaluation: Evaluate transactions from a risk/return perspective and present applications to the Company and/or Bank Management.
  • Credit Applications: Prepare credit applications including due diligence financial modelling sensitivity analysis and negotiation of commercial and financing agreements.
  • Post-Approval Management: Oversee post-approval processes including closing and first disbursement portfolio performance monitoring and handling requests for consents waivers and amendments.

Your defining qualities:
  • Education: University degree in Finance Economics Management or equivalent ideally with a finance-related post-graduation or professional qualification.
  • Experience: Min 10 years of credit (risk) experience specializing in corporate lending and leveraged finance transactions in the Asia/Australia region.
  • Skills: Strong financial modeling abilities and profound knowledge of complex financial structures and transaction analysis.
  • Risk Assessment: Keen ability to identify and assess risks in transactions and evaluate risk mitigation measures.
  • Jurisdictional Awareness: Familiarity with jurisdictional differences in major Asian geographies related to security and guarantees.
  • Additional Skills: Proficiency in reviewing and negotiating legal documentation fluency in English leadership skills analytical decision-making ability and capacity to work effectively under pressure within diverse teams.
